Northland news in brief: Bay waka ama festival postponed; and dairy industry awards tonight 8 Mar, 2021 04:00 PM 3 minutes to read Paddlers compete in the Kris Kjeldsen Memorial Race/Te Taiawhio o Ipipiri during a previous Bay of Islands Waka Ama Festival. Photo / Ruth Lawton Northern Advocate The Bay of Islands Waka Ama Festival, which was to have been held at Waitangi on March 13-14, has been postponed due to Covid-19 concerns. A new date has yet to be set. Organisers said they had to decide whether the event would go ahead last week before it was known whether Auckland s level 3 alert would be lifted. Many paddlers had been expected to travel from south of Auckland for the festival.
